In the pharmaceutical industry, the quality of raw materials and intermediates directly impacts the safety, efficacy, and regulatory compliance of finished drug products. Ethyl 2-(4-hydroxyphenyl)-4-methylthiazole-5-carboxylate (CAS 161797-99-5) is a prime example of an intermediate where stringent quality assurance is non-negotiable. This compound is a critical precursor for APIs like Febuxostat, making its purity and consistency paramount. For R&D scientists and procurement managers, understanding the quality control measures employed by manufacturers is vital for ensuring successful research and production.

The primary quality parameter for Ethyl 2-(4-hydroxyphenyl)-4-methylthiazole-5-carboxylate is its purity, typically specified at 98% or higher. Manufacturers achieve this through meticulous control over the synthesis process, from the selection of high-grade raw materials to the final purification steps. Analytical techniques such as High-Performance Liquid Chromatography (HPLC), Gas Chromatography (GC), Nuclear Magnetic Resonance (NMR) spectroscopy, and Mass Spectrometry (MS) are routinely used to confirm the compound's identity, assay, and impurity profile. A detailed Certificate of Analysis (CoA) provided by the manufacturer is the cornerstone of quality verification.

Beyond purity, other critical aspects of quality assurance include batch-to-batch consistency, stability, and proper packaging. Ensuring that each manufactured batch of Ethyl 2-(4-hydroxyphenyl)-4-methylthiazole-5-carboxylate meets the same high standards is essential for reproducible results in pharmaceutical synthesis. Manufacturers should also provide data on the compound's stability under various storage conditions, ensuring its integrity from the production site to the client's laboratory. Proper packaging prevents contamination and degradation during transit.
